Santo Domingo Sur pit, Diego de Almagro, Chañaral Province, Atacama, Chile

Mineral Occurrences

LocalityMineral(s)
Santo Domingo Sur pit, Diego de Almagro, Chañaral Province, Atacama, Chile Actinolite, Albite, Bornite, Calcite, Chalcopyrite, Chlorite Group, Epidote, Hematite, K Feldspar, Magnetite, Mushketovite, Pyrite, Quartz, Specularite, Titanite
